'A Foreign Affair' Provides the Laughs, Dahling.
This postwar comedy with Marlene Dietrich as an acid-tongued nightclub singer with suspected Nazi ties and Jean Arthur as a visiting no-nonsense Congresswoman from Iowa both after the same army heel with a guilty conscience starts slowly but gets in full gear when the romantic entanglements commence. Both actresses are terrific.
